Output ddbee391aebca317880183105f373eeec5765d87ee7fde0af02897b11ac87824:1

value
49394252
script pubkey
OP_0 OP_PUSHBYTES_20 6c21478e8dd32718616e91e47c5520c50a6ce0eb
address
bc1qdss50r5d6vn3sctwj8j8c4fqc59xec8tfw9txq
transaction
ddbee391aebca317880183105f373eeec5765d87ee7fde0af02897b11ac87824
spent
true